PUBLIC HEARING ANNEXATION PETITION - KEY PROPERTIES /c)
A public hearing was held in regard to a petition for annexation to the City of Tukwila
certain property located along Macadam Road in: vicinity of South 133rd.
Mr. David Jensen, 200 - 112th N.E. Bellevue, owner of a portion of the property spoke
in favor of the annexation. He explained he has purchased a parcel of property, part
of which is in unincorporated King County and part within the City of Tukwila. The
property in question is owned by him and Mr. Ted Gusa. He wishes to have the property
annexed in order to develop the entire parcel under one building department jurisdic-
tion and under one zoning.
Mr. Hill asked why the code would present a problem since both the City and the County
operated under the Uniform Building Code. Mr. Jensen explained it would be a matter of
who inspects and a difference in the fee schedule. Also there was a possibility of a
building spanning the City - County line. His Financial advisors have advised him to get
all the property under one jurisdiction.
Mr. Sterling asked if the pie shaped area omited from the annexation request was part
of -the development. Mr. Jensen replied not at this time.
Mayor Minkler asked for anyone wishing to speak against the annexation. There was no
objection raised.
Mr. Hill made a motion the Public Hearing be closed. Motion seconded by Mr. Gardner
and carried.
Mr Hill made a motion the council acce t the annexation tition sub ect to apa val
of the Boundary Review Board. Motion seconded b Mr. Johanson and c rried.

As required by RCW Chapter 36.93, a Notice of Intention is hereby
submitted by the City of Tukwila to annex, by the petition method,
that area contiguous to the present southeasterly corporate limits
of the City of Tukwila.
Owners of the property involved, GACO Western, Inc., petitioned the
City of Tukwila for annexation of their property to be included
within the corporate limits of the City of Tukwila. The City
Council, on 6 December 1971, approved the proposed annexation
and authorized the submission of this Notice of Intention.
Exhibit 1: Letter from GACO Western, Inc. requesting annexation.
Exhibit 2: Statement from registered Engineer.
Exhibit 3: Legal description of property involved.
Exhibit 4: Vicinity map of area involved.
Exhibit 5: King County Assessor's map including proposed
annexation.
Exhibit 6: Map of present corporate limits of City of Tukwila.
Exhibit 7: The required $25.00 filing fee.
The area involved encompasses approximately five and one —half
acres and its assessed valuation is less than $200,000. Conse—
quently, the City of Tukwila, in accordance with RCM Chapter
35.13.172, requests the King County Boundary Review Board waive
requirements for approval of the proposed annexation.

We respectfully request that property we own contiguous to your south
city limits east of Southcenter Parkway be annexed to the City of Tukwila.
Enclosed is a survey of the property (Exhibit A) with the relevant portion.
outlined in red. Approximately 5-1/2 acres are involved. Legal descrip-
tions are attached to describe the individual ownerships involved.
Exhibit B is a description of the entire area for which we are seeking
annexation.
Exhibit C describes Tract 3, the portion of the entire tract which is
now owned by the Trustees of the Gaco Western,.Inc. Profit Sharing Plan.
the portion of the tract which is now owned
by Alaska Sea Vans, Inc. /dba Mitchell Moving and Storage.
Our company is acquiring the remaining area of the original tract, that
lying generally south of the "Alaska" tract under a purchase contract
from Mr. Toke Toyoshima.
Mr. Hugh Mitchell, President of Alaska Sea Vans, Inc. concurs in this
request. Mr. Mitchell, Mrs. Lucy Heiserman and I, the three trustees of
the Gaco Western, Inc. Profit Sharing Fund, support the request. There-
fore, all owners of the property involved join in urging your acceptance
and approval of this petition.
I have asked M. Fritz Gunter, owner of the narrow parcel lying between
our property and the road, whether he wishes to join in this petition.
As of now he has not advised us of his decision so we are proceeding on
our own.
